Metabolism
The set of life-sustaining chemical reactions in organisms, crucial for converting food to energy, constructing cellular components, and managing waste materials.
Calcium Levels
The concentration of calcium ions (Ca2+) in the body, critical for various physiological processes, including bone formation, muscle function, and signal transduction.
Glucagon
A hormone produced by the pancreas that works to raise blood glucose levels by stimulating the breakdown of glycogen in the liver.
Glycogen
A complex carbohydrate stored in the liver and muscles of animals, serving as a primary form of energy storage.
